Output 598db6f68733972aa73147f5ea48538e0af9addb15b20fc0c0e7ffd322a6b9b2:1

value
4398602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f60f2c27e3383d93cd74bc001bdc8cca25334d OP_EQUAL
address
3P7NovsmQXjpBgpX6UWeHSwB1faj4HsnTv
transaction
598db6f68733972aa73147f5ea48538e0af9addb15b20fc0c0e7ffd322a6b9b2
spent
true